The CrossFit Approach
CrossFit builds strength through constantly varied functional movements:
Squatting, pushing, pulling, hinging, carrying.
Movements that mimic real life, not just gym machines.
And we follow a simple formula: mechanics → consistency → intensity.
First move well, then move often, then move fast or heavy.
A Strength Workout You Can Do Anywhere
You don’t need fancy equipment to start building a base.
Try this 20-minute session:
5 Rounds:
10 Push-ups
15 Air Squats
20 Sit-ups
30s Plank Hold
This simple combo hits push, pull, squat, and core — the cornerstones of functional strength.
